I guess I can say I’ve used all flock for the little ones also. I just put a dish with the starter and another with some mushy all flock incase she tries offering it, that way she won’t be offering big crumbles/pellets. I also like fermenting their scratch grains and sometimes the all flock. I just blend it up a bit (scratch) and they go bananas for it, so adorable.I also use an all flock feed from the start... ironically my chicks don't actually get starter feed until about 2 weeks old, when they start getting a little time with the adults (and the adults are eating it too). This is due to the size of the starter feed I use (the all flock crumble is smaller and easier for them to eat.)
